Content discovery site StumbleUpon has hired former Digitas executive Teal Newland as its first vice
president of sales. In that capacity, she will oversee all of the company’s ad sales efforts for its paid discovery platform and report directly to CEO and co-founder Garrett Camp.
Newland was most recently a vice president and group director of global brand content at Digitas, leading the practice for brands including American Express, Delta Airlines, Intel and Asus. Prior
to Digitas, she was head of brand strategy for Disney Innovation, overseeing digital creative, social and media strategy across all Disney business lines.
StumbleUpon says more than 75,000
brands, publishers and other marketers have used its paid discovery offering launched last year to reach its 20 million users.
